The British School of Beijing, Sanlitun is looking for outstanding Early Years Teachers who can inspire and engage students to become ‘Global Learners, Aspiring Leaders’. For us this means preparing our students for the leadership challenges of the 21st century and providing them with the skills, values, attitudes and attributes that they will need in order to achieve success and help them aspire to be the best that they can be. All of this begins in the Early Years Foundation Stage where strong foundations are formed and focus is placed on developing early social and academic skills.

Conveniently located in the cosmopolitan district of Sanlitun, our school resides in the heart of Beijing’s second Embassy district and we are the only British International School in the downtown area. We are a specialist Early Years and Primary school catering for students aged 1 to 11 and we follow the EYFS Framework and English National Curriculum which we tailor to meet the needs of our international students. We have over 400 students and a team of creative, inspiring and committed teachers, which as a result leads to excellent learning outcomes from all our children. We are now looking for like-minded professionals to join our talented team.

In addition to being highly successful in its own right, The British School of Beijing, Sanlitun is a member of the Nord Anglia Education family of premium international schools.  This means you will be joining an international team in which thoughts and ideas are shared around the globe as we strive to make our schools the very best in the world and you will have the security and opportunities that come from being part of a high quality global organisation dedicated to education. With 35 schools across Asia, the Middle East, Europe and North America it is an exciting time to be joining Nord Anglia Education.

In return for your passion to deliver a quality education you will enjoy a competitive salary, accommodation provided by us, an annual flight allowance, subsidised healthcare and places in the school for your children.  You will have the opportunity to live in and work in China’s capital city; a dynamic and ever changing environment.

About The British School of Beijing, Sanlitun

Families choose The British School of Beijing, Sanlitun because of our dedication to learning and our ability to meet the needs of each and every one of our students. As the only British International School in downtown Beijing, we are well placed within the leafy embassy district and as a result deliver a British based curriculum to students from over fifty nationalities. Our school has two campuses which are a few minutes’ walk from each other; the Early Years Campus which is especially for our Pre Nursery and Nursery students and the Primary campus at which students aged five to eleven attend. We provide a family oriented atmosphere in which parents can be certain that their children are being cared for and supported in all aspects of their learning.

At our school we have a team of teachers and teaching assistants who are passionate about teaching and learning and who are committed to ensuring all our students achieve success in all aspects of their development, both social and academic. As a team of educators we encourage every child within our care to take risks in their learning and experiment with ideas, whilst providing a safe and supportive learning environment in which to do so.

It is important for all members of our school community to be confident, resilient members of a global society and we place high importance on embedding values of respect, patience and tolerance for all.
